feat(privacy): scan ingested sources for customer-identifying data
Detection-only scan (internal/privacy) attached to every AnalysisResult: a customer-domain guess plus a findings list (category, file, line, match, hint), ported from the KB grep playbook. Runs on archive uploads and the serialized Redfish tree; gated by LOGPILE_PRIVACY_SCAN (default on). Surfaced at GET /api/privacy-scan, in the "Customer data" UI panel, and as privacy_report.json in the raw-export bundle. IP policy keeps RFC1918 and example ranges out of findings; allowlist covers standards-body and vendor infrastructure domains. No customer tokens in the repo. See ADL-066 and bible-local/docs/privacy-scan.md.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 5 <noreply@anthropic.com>
